    With the development of the petrochemical industry, pipeline inspection technology plays a vital role in terms of avoiding explosions and protecting people's life and property. Pipelines working in high-temperature environments suffer from dual dangers of internal and external wall defects. It is often difficult to find a single nondestructive testing (NDT) method that can cover internal and external defects detection especially in high-temperature environments. In order to discover pipeline defects in time, we propose a hybrid online monitoring method for comprehensive defects inspection in high-temperature environments. This hybrid monitoring method combines eddy current testing (ECT) with electromagnetic acoustic transducer (EMAT) techniques. Specifically, we split the coil signal into two channels; one channel gives ECT signal and the other gives EMAT signal; furthermore, we demonstrate the feasibility of the proposed hybrid monitoring method by numerical simulations and laboratory experiments. The results show that the proposed hybrid online monitoring method can be used successfully to simultaneously monitor surface and internal defects and has high stability even at temperatures above 300 °C. Our approach achieves the genuine integration of ECT/EMAT technologies, effectively addressing the challenge of incomplete monitoring of pipeline defects in high-temperature environments.
